James BRINKMAN Obituary
At age 87, husband, father, and grandfather, James Frederick Brinkman, MD, quietly passed on January 16, 2023, surrounded by his family. He was born to his parents, Frederick C. and Cleo (Baggett) Brinkman on November 10, 1935, in Wichita, Kanas... Read James BRINKMAN's Obituary
